摘要: A cab includes a cab frame forming the cab, an outer roof configured to cover said cab frame from above and to be fastened to the cab frame from above, a seal mount protruding downwardly from an edge of the outer roof, and a seal material including a body portion having a recess for receiving the seal mount. The periphery of the body portion of the seal material has a seal lip for contacting said cab frame for sealing, and a drain groove for draining water entering between said seal material and said cab frame.

摘要: A mounting arrangement for mounting a cooler unit to a work machine has a traveling device, a machine body frame, an engine and the cooler unit disposed adjacent the engine. The arrangement includes a support deck provided in the machine body frame for supporting the cooler unit, an attachment unit for releasably fixing the cooler unit to the machine body frame and a movement mechanism provided between the cooler unit and the support deck, the movement mechanism allowing the cooler unit to effect a translational movement to change a distance relative to the engine.

摘要: A hood for a loader work machine is provided at the rear end of the frame body and downwardly of the transverse connecting member between the pair of right/left support frame members. The transverse connecting member includes a front wall plate and an upper wall plate projecting rearward from an upper end of the front wall plate. The upper wall plate of the transverse connecting member is disposed more downwardly than the vertical center of the cabin. A rear portion of the upper wall plate is inclined downwardly rearward. A hood upper wall is provided for covering a rear upper side between the pair of right/left support frame members. A front end portion of the hood upper wall is connected to the rear portion of the upper wall plate of the transverse connecting member. The hood upper wall is inclined downwardly rearward in correspondence with the rear portion of the upper wall plate.

摘要: A loader work machine is disclosed in which a base portion of each of right/left arms (77) is received by an arm support portion (164) of a first lift link (81) and pivotally supported by a first arm shaft (88), and a hydraulic pipe arrangement (167) connected to a hydraulic actuator (98) extend through an support frame (11) from inside to outside of its inner wall (12), and toward an arm (77). The base portion of the arm (77) is supported to the arm support portion (164) at a position adjacent a link outer wall (157) in a transverse direction so that a hose accommodation space (165) is formed between a link inner wall (156) and an internal side face of the base portion of the arm (77). The hydraulic pipe arrangement (167) runs frontward of the first arm shaft (88) and a first link shaft (85), and is disposed in the hose accommodation space (165).

摘要: Positional relationship among the first link support shaft (85), the second link support shaft (86), the first arm support shaft (88) and the second arm support shaft (89) is set such that an upper portion of the first lift link (81) comes into substantial agreement with a rear end of the machine body (1), when the upper free end of the first lift link (81) is pivoted maximally rearward in the course of transition of the arm (77) from a lowermost state realized lifting down the arm (77) to an uppermost state realized by lifting up the arm (77).
